Associate Professor of Psychology

Dr. Gordon holds a bachelor’s degree in psychology and English from Wabash College in Crawfordsville, Ind., as well as a master’s degree in educational psychology and a Ph.D. in counseling psychology from the University of Texas at Austin. His dissertation title was “Men, Masculinity, and Heterosexual Exclusivity: A Study of the Perception and Construction of Human Sexual Orientation.” His research and scholarly interests include neurodivergence, personality theory, sports and performance psychology, human sexuality and gender, and race, ethnicity and culture.
